Noah Cyrus -- whose big sister is "Hannah Montana" star Miley -- had a dream that was similar to millions of other young girls around the world: she wanted to meet Justin Bieber. Luckily for her, she has a certain pop star in the family that can make that dream happen.

Though their meeting was short-lived, Noah had an opportunity to take a photo with the "Baby" singer on Monday, when both him and Miley were booked on ABC's "The View." Of course, both of them were all smiles for the photo -- though there's no word on it Noah busted out any of the dance moves she used in the video below.

Justin Bieber fans around the world are celebrating the release of his "My World 2.0" album Tuesday, and the singer will be making another appearance on "The View" to perform with his full band.
